# provider
provider "aws" {
region = "ap-northeast-1"
}
# resource
#create vpc
resource "aws_vpc" "hyperverge" {
cidr_block = "10.0.0.0/16"
tags = {
"name" = "hyperverge"
}
enable_dns_support = true
enable_dns_hostnames = true
}
#create 2 public subnet for instances in different region
resource "aws_subnet" "PublicSubnetA" {
vpc_id = aws_vpc.hyperverge.id
availability_zone = "ap-northeast-1a"
cidr_block = "10.0.1.0/24"
}
resource "aws_subnet" "PublicSubnetB" {
vpc_id = aws_vpc.hyperverge.id
availability_zone = "ap-northeast-1c"
cidr_block = "10.0.2.0/24"
}
# create igw
resource "aws_internet_gateway" "myigw" {
vpc_id = aws_vpc.hyperverge.id
}
# create a route table + make it a main rt
resource "aws_route_table" "PublicRT" {
vpc_id = aws_vpc.hyperverge.id
route {
cidr_block = "0.0.0.0/0"
gateway_id = aws_internet_gateway.myigw.id
}
}
resource "aws_main_route_table_association" "main" {
vpc_id = aws_vpc.hyperverge.id
route_table_id = aws_route_table.PublicRT.id
}
#route table association for both subnets
resource "aws_route_table_association" "a" {
subnet_id = aws_subnet.PublicSubnetA.id
route_table_id = aws_route_table.PublicRT.id
}
resource "aws_route_table_association" "b" {
subnet_id = aws_subnet.PublicSubnetB.id
route_table_id = aws_route_table.PublicRT.id
}
# security group for allowing traffic on port 80, 22
resource "aws_security_group" "allow_traffic" {
name = "allow_traffic"
vpc_id = aws_vpc.hyperverge.id
description = "Allow inbound traffic"
ingress {
from_port = 80
to_port = 80
protocol = "tcp"
cidr_blocks = ["0.0.0.0/0"]
}
ingress {
from_port = 22
to_port = 22
protocol = "tcp"
cidr_blocks = ["0.0.0.0/0"]
}
egress {
from_port = 0
to_port = 0
protocol = "-1"
cidr_blocks = ["0.0.0.0/0"]
}
tags = {
Name = "sg_hyperverge2"
}
}
# keypair for aws instance
resource "aws_key_pair" "hyperverge2_key" {
key_name = "hyperverge2_key"
public_key = tls_private_key.rsa.public_key_openssh
}
resource "tls_private_key" "rsa" {
algorithm = "RSA"
rsa_bits = 4096
}
resource "local_file" "hyperverge2_key" {
content = tls_private_key.rsa.private_key_pem
filename = "hyperverge2_key"
}
# aws instance for static website
resource "aws_instance" "hyperverge2" {
ami = "ami-06ee4e2261a4dc5c3"
instance_type = "t2.micro"
subnet_id = aws_subnet.PublicSubnetA.id
associate_public_ip_address = true
vpc_security_group_ids = [aws_security_group.allow_traffic.id]
key_name = "hyperverge2_key"
user_data = file("script.sh")
tags = {
Name = "hyperverge2"
}
}
# 2nd aws instance for static website
resource "aws_instance" "hyperverge3" {
ami = "ami-06ee4e2261a4dc5c3"
instance_type = "t2.micro"
subnet_id = aws_subnet.PublicSubnetB.id
associate_public_ip_address = true
vpc_security_group_ids = [aws_security_group.allow_traffic.id]
key_name = "hyperverge2_key"
user_data = file("script.sh")
tags = {
Name = "hyperverge3"
}
}
#create security group for ALB
resource "aws_security_group" "sg_application_lb" {
name = "sg_application_lb"
vpc_id = aws_vpc.hyperverge.id
ingress {
from_port = 80
to_port = 80
protocol = "tcp"
cidr_blocks = ["0.0.0.0/0"]
}
egress {
from_port = "0"
to_port = "0"
protocol = "-1"
cidr_blocks = ["0.0.0.0/0"]
}
tags = {
Name = "sg_application_lb"
}
}
#create ALB
resource "aws_lb" "lb_hyperverge" {
name = "hyperverge-elb"
internal = false
load_balancer_type = "application"
subnets = [aws_subnet.PublicSubnetA.id, aws_subnet.PublicSubnetB.id]
security_groups = [aws_security_group.sg_application_lb.id]
enable_deletion_protection = false
tags = {
Name = "hyperverge-elb"
}
}
#create target group
resource "aws_lb_target_group" "hyperverge_vms" {
name = "tf-hyperverge-lb-tg"
port = 80
protocol = "HTTP"
vpc_id = aws_vpc.hyperverge.id
}
#create listner for ALB
resource "aws_lb_listener" "front_end" {
load_balancer_arn = aws_lb.lb_hyperverge.arn
port = "80"
protocol = "HTTP"
default_action {
type = "forward"
target_group_arn = aws_lb_target_group.hyperverge_vms.arn
}
}
#add host to target group
resource "aws_lb_target_group_attachment" "hyperverge2_tg_attachment" {
target_group_arn = aws_lb_target_group.hyperverge_vms.arn
target_id = aws_instance.hyperverge2.id
port = 80
}
resource "aws_lb_target_group_attachment" "hyperverge3_tg_attachment" {
target_group_arn = aws_lb_target_group.hyperverge_vms.arn
target_id = aws_instance.hyperverge3.id
port = 80
}
